O modem Huawei EC156 não é mais detectado depois de desconectado

1

Acabei de instalar o Ubuntu 13.04 Raring. Agora estou enfrentando um problema com o meu modem Huawei EC156.

A princípio, ele funcionará corretamente, mas desaparecerá do gerenciador de rede se o modem for desconectado após on-line ou removido do slot USB. O 'Enable Mobile Broadband' também desapareceria do Network Manager. O modem aparecerá novamente se eu usá-lo no Windows e depois executá-lo novamente no Ubuntu.

Se o modem for detectado corretamente, o dmesg mostrará algo assim:

New USB device found, idVendor=12d1, idProduct=140c

mas, se não for detectado, o dmesg mostrará este resultado:

New USB device found, idVendor=12d1, idProduct=1505

Eu nunca vi esse problema antes em versões anteriores do Ubuntu. Como posso consertar isso?

    
por pram 12.05.2013 / 08:00

2 respostas

0

Eu encontrei a resposta de este blog . É em indonésio, então eu gostaria de traduzir e explicar um pouco.

Tudo o que você precisa é de dois passos simples:

  1. Escreva um arquivo para usb_modeswitch:

    # nano /etc/usb_modeswitch.d/12d1:1505
    

    Preencha o arquivo com este texto:

    DefaultVendor= 0x12d1 
    DefaultProduct=0x1505 
    MessageContent="55534243123456780000000000000011062000000100000000000000000000"
    
  2. Emitir comando:

    # usb_modeswitch -I -W -c /etc/usb_modeswitch.d/12d1:1505
    

Agora o modem deve ter mudado de modo e pode ser detectado pelo NetworkManager.

    
por pram 05.07.2013 / 10:24
0

Provavelmente você poderia ter tentado o que estou prestes a dizer.

lsusb

usb-devices

Os comandos acima listarão os dispositivos usb conectados à sua máquina.

No entanto, o método a seguir funciona sempre para mim. Conecte o dispositivo USB antes de ligar seu laptop.

Após o login, digite os seguintes comandos no seu terminal:

dmesg -c

Por favor, anote as impressões de que seu modem foi detectado.

lsusb

E receba o fornecedor e o dispositivo do seu dispositivo identificação do produto.

modprobe option

service network-manager restart

echo 12D1 140C > /sys/bus/usb-serial/drivers/option1/new_id

dmesg

Agora você deve ver algumas alterações em dmesg detectando seu dispositivo usb como um modem. Caso contrário, após dmesg -c , tente modprobe -r usb_storage , o que removerá o suporte para dispositivos de armazenamento USB. Às vezes, o seu modem é detectado como armazenamento USB. Após o seu modem ser detectado, você pode reativar o armazenamento usb por modprobe option .

Espero que isso ajude.

    
por Manikanda raj S 18.05.2013 / 12:33